Space Discovery: Jacre – “If You See her”
Jacre’s latest single If You See Her is an emotional slow-burn that hits right in the feels. Known for his atmospheric and evocative sound, Jacre doesn’t disappoint with this ballad, blending rich piano chords and soaring string arrangements to craft a song that’s both delicate and powerful.
The track opens with a soft, melancholic piano melody that immediately sets the mood. The sparse arrangement gives space for Jacre’s vocals to shine, and he wastes no time pulling you into the emotional core of the song. His voice is smooth yet raw, conveying the bittersweet ache of someone leaving behind a person they still love. There’s an underlying vulnerability in his delivery, especially as he hits those tender high notes, making the pain feel all too real.
The lyrics are poetic but not overly complex, which makes them all the more impactful. Jacre’s ability to capture a universal feeling of loss and longing is striking. Lines like “If you see her, tell her she’s still on my mind” hit hard, evoking that heart-wrenching experience of wanting someone to be loved even when you’re no longer in the picture. It’s a simple but profound message wrapped in a beautiful package of carefully crafted words.
Musically, the song builds slowly but surely, with strings gradually joining the piano to give the arrangement an epic, cinematic quality. The crescendo toward the end is stunning, as the strings swell and Jacre’s voice reaches new emotional heights. It’s the kind of track that feels like a journey, taking the listener from quiet reflection to an almost cathartic release.

If You See Her is more than just a ballad — it’s an emotional experience. Jacre’s ability to pair heartfelt lyrics with lush, dynamic instrumentation makes this track one to put on repeat when you’re in your feelings.
